SAP EWM is a robust, integrated warehouse management solution designed to manage high-volume warehouse operations. Unlike the basic SAP WM (Warehouse Management) module, EWM offers more flexibility, better integration with automated systems, and advanced features like labor management and yard management. Key Differences: SAP WM vs. SAP EWM

Complexity: WM is suited for simple storage; EWM handles complex processing.

Automation: EWM has built-in Material Flow Systems (MFS) to talk directly to PLCs and conveyors.

Granularity: EWM allows for finer control over work centers and internal movements. 2. Core Components of SAP EWM

To master SAP EWM, you must understand its architectural building blocks: Organizational Structure

Warehouse Number: The highest level of organizational unit in EWM.

Storage Type: Physical or logical subdivisions (e.g., high-rack, cold storage, receiving area).

Storage Section: Subdivisions of a storage type based on putaway strategy.

Storage Bin: The smallest addressable unit in the warehouse. Master Data

Introduction SAP Extended Warehouse Management (EWM) is a comprehensive warehouse-management solution that supports complex logistics processes across inbound, outbound, storage, and value-added services. A “SAP EWM guide PDF” typically refers to downloadable manuals, implementation guides, or user guides in PDF format that distill EWM concepts, configuration steps, process flows, and best practices. This essay examines what such PDFs usually contain, their practical value for different audiences, their limitations, and recommendations for finding and using them effectively. sap ewm guide pdf

What a SAP EWM guide PDF usually contains

  • Overview and architecture

    • High-level description of SAP EWM within the SAP Supply Chain Execution suite, integration points with SAP S/4HANA, SAP ERP, and external systems.
    • System architecture diagrams, deployment options (decentralized vs. embedded), and key master data objects (products, storage bins, warehouses).
  • Core process modules and flows

    • Inbound processes: advanced shipping notifications (ASN), goods receipt, putaway strategies, and replenishment.
    • Storage and internal warehouse operations: storage types, storage sections, handling units, slotting, bin management, and physical inventory.
    • Outbound processes: pick strategies (FIFO/LIFO, wave, cluster), packing, staging, loading, and goods issue.
    • Value-added services: kitting, inspection, quality integration, cross-docking, and returns processing.
  • Configuration and customizing steps

    • Step-by-step guidance on IMG nodes and key customizing settings (warehouse number, storage type control, movement types, task and resource management).
    • Examples of configuration screens, parameter explanations, and typical decision rules (e.g., putaway/removal strategies).
  • Integration and interfaces

    • EWM integration with ERP or S/4HANA (CIF, IDoc, core interface), inbound/outbound IDoc messages, SAP TM, and third-party systems.
    • Barcode/RFID device integration, mobile data entry (RF frameworks), and middleware considerations.
  • Technical components and extensions

    • Warehouse order and task creation logic, resource management (e.g., labor), slotting and optimization, and warehouse performance monitoring.
    • Custom enhancements, BAdIs, user-exits, and typical ABAP/extension points.
  • Best practices and design patterns

    • Recommendations for warehouse layout mapping, bin-sizing, picking optimization, and mixed-storage strategies.
    • Common pitfalls during implementation and data-migration checklists.
  • Examples, screenshots, and sample transactions

    • Walkthroughs of typical transactions (e.g., creating a goods receipt, confirming tasks) and example document flows.
  • Troubleshooting and FAQs

    • Common error messages, performance tuning tips, and points of coordination between functional and technical teams.

Limitations and cautions

  • Versioning and currency: SAP EWM evolves; PDFs can become outdated quickly—especially concerning integration with newer S/4HANA releases, cloud deployments, or recent feature additions.
  • Vendor vs. community accuracy: Official SAP documentation has authoritative detail but may be dense; community PDFs or third-party guides vary in accuracy and may omit edge cases.
  • Lack of interactivity: Static PDFs can’t replace sandbox practice, simulation, or hands-on testing essential for real-world implementations.
  • Licensing and IP concerns: Not all EWM materials are public—official SAP guides may require SAP support access; unofficial redistribution of licensed SAP content can violate terms.

How to evaluate and use a SAP EWM guide PDF effectively

  • Check publication date and target release (e.g., EWM on S/4HANA 2020, 2021, or standalone EWM versions). Use the most recent guide that matches your system.
  • Verify authorship and source: prefer official SAP Help Portal guides, SAP Press books, or reputable consulting firms and community experts.
  • Cross-reference with SAP Help Portal and SAP Notes: use PDFs for broad understanding and official SAP channels for fixes, patches, and exact configuration behaviors.
  • Use as a companion to a sandbox system: translate steps from the PDF into hands-on exercises in a non-production EWM environment.
  • Maintain a versioned implementation playbook: extract relevant sections into a live document that you keep updated during project phases.

Mastering Logistics: Your Comprehensive SAP EWM Guide SAP Extended Warehouse Management (EWM) is a high-performance software solution designed to manage complex warehouse processes. Unlike traditional inventory management, EWM provides granular control over every stock movement, from the moment a truck arrives at the gate to the final dispatch of goods.

This guide provides a deep dive into the architecture, core processes, and implementation steps of SAP EWM. 1. Understanding the SAP EWM Architecture

SAP EWM operates as a standalone system or as part of the SAP S/4HANA digital core. Its architecture is built for high-volume environments that require real-time visibility.

Warehouse Structure: A warehouse is organized into a hierarchy of unique Warehouse Numbers, which are further divided into Storage Types (e.g., high-rack, cold storage), Storage Sections, and individual Storage Bins.

ERP Integration: EWM typically communicates with an ERP system (like SAP ECC or S/4HANA) using documents like Inbound and Outbound Deliveries.

Radio Frequency (RF) Framework: A key architectural component that allows warehouse workers to perform tasks using mobile handheld scanners or tablets in real time. 2. Core Warehouse Processes

The functionality of SAP EWM is generally categorized into three main process flows: Inbound Processes Managing the receipt of goods from suppliers or production.

Goods Receipt (GR): Confirming the arrival of physical goods.

Quality Inspection: Integrated checks to ensure goods meet standards before storage.

Deconsolidation: Breaking down large handling units into smaller, bin-specific units.

Putaway: Moving products to their final storage locations based on Slotting rules that optimize space and turnover frequency. Outbound Processes

Focusing on fulfilling customer orders with speed and accuracy.

Wave Management: Bundling multiple orders into "waves" to optimize picking routes and resource allocation.

Picking and Packing: System-guided activities that direct workers to the exact bin location and specify the required packaging.

Staging and Loading: Moving packed goods to a specific "door" or staging area for truck loading. Internal Processes
